Keizo Kashihara is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Aerospace Engineering and Mechanical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Keizo Kashihara has authored 39 papers receiving a total of 366 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 31 papers in Materials Chemistry, 27 papers in Aerospace Engineering and 26 papers in Mechanical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Keizo Kashihara’s work include Microstructure and mechanical properties (28 papers), Aluminum Alloy Microstructure Properties (27 papers) and Aluminum Alloys Composites Properties (10 papers). Keizo Kashihara is often cited by papers focused on Microstructure and mechanical properties (28 papers), Aluminum Alloy Microstructure Properties (27 papers) and Aluminum Alloys Composites Properties (10 papers). Keizo Kashihara coll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Australia. Keizo Kashihara's co-authors include Fukuji Inoko, Tatsuya Okada, Nobuhiro Tsuji, Toshiya Shibayanagi, Daisuke Terada, A.P. Gerlich, J. A. Wert, Kazuo Yamazaki, Makoto Fujishima and Wei Li and has published in prestigious journals such as Materials Science and Engineering A, Metallurgical and Materials Transactions A and The International Journal of Advanced Manufacturing Technology.
